Introduction
The world of blockchain and cryptocurrencies has witnessed unprecedented growth and innovation over the past decade. Yet, as the popularity of cryptocurrencies like Bitcoin and Ethereum has surged, so too have their limitations become increasingly apparent. Chief among these limitations is scalability – the ability of a blockchain network to handle a growing number of transactions efficiently.
In this article, we delve into the fascinating realm of Layer 2 Blockchains, an ingenious solution designed to address the scalability challenges that have plagued Layer 1 Blockchains like Bitcoin and Ethereum. These Layer 2 solutions represent a pivotal development in the evolution of blockchain technology, offering a promising path toward mainstream adoption and the realization of blockchain's full potential.
Understanding Layer 2 Blockchains
To grasp the significance of Layer 2 Blockchains, it's essential to first understand the core concepts behind them. In essence, Layer 2 solutions are complementary networks built atop existing Layer 1 Blockchains, such as Bitcoin or Ethereum. They serve as an additional layer that processes transactions and data off-chain, thereby relieving congestion and enhancing performance on the Layer 1 network.
The primary goal of Layer 2 solutions is to significantly increase the transaction throughput, reduce fees, and minimize latency. They achieve this by handling many transactions 'off-chain,' which means that these transactions are processed outside the main blockchain network. This approach ensures that only the final results are recorded on the Layer 1 blockchain, improving efficiency and scalability.
Types of Layer 2 Solutions
Layer 2 Blockchains encompass a diverse array of solutions, each with its own unique approach to scalability and transaction processing. Below, we explore some of the most notable types of Layer 2 solutions.
Sidechains
Sidechains are independent blockchains connected to the main Layer 1 blockchain. They allow assets to be moved from the main blockchain to the sidechain for faster and cheaper transactions. Sidechains enable innovative features and use cases while maintaining a connection to the security of the primary blockchain.
State Channels
State channels are off-chain, bi-directional communication channels between participants. They allow parties to transact privately and quickly without involving the main blockchain for every interaction. State channels are especially valuable for applications requiring frequent microtransactions, like gaming or streaming.
Rollups
Rollups are Layer 2 solutions that bundle multiple transactions into a single batch and submit them to the Layer 1 blockchain as a single entry. They come in two main types: Optimistic Rollups and ZK-Rollups. Optimistic Rollups make use of smart contracts for dispute resolution, while ZK-Rollups rely on zero-knowledge proofs for scalability and privacy.
These are just a few examples of Layer 2 solutions, and each has its strengths and trade-offs. It's worth noting that developers and projects can choose the Layer 2 solution that best suits their specific use case.
Benefits of Layer 2 Blockchains
Layer 2 Blockchains offer a host of compelling advantages that make them an essential part of the blockchain ecosystem. Here are some key benefits to consider.
Improved Scalability
The most prominent benefit of Layer 2 solutions is their ability to significantly enhance blockchain scalability. By processing the majority of transactions off-chain and then settling the results on the Layer 1 blockchain, Layer 2 networks can handle a vastly larger number of transactions per second. This scalability boost is crucial for accommodating the growing demand for blockchain applications.
Reduced Transaction Fees
One of the most glaring issues with Layer 1 Blockchains like Ethereum has been the unpredictably high transaction fees during periods of network congestion. Layer 2 solutions alleviate this problem by enabling fast and low-cost transactions. Users no longer need to compete for limited block space, resulting in more predictable and affordable fees.
Faster Confirmation Times
Layer 2 solutions offer near-instantaneous transaction confirmation. Since transactions are processed off-chain, they don't suffer from the latency inherent in Layer 1 networks. This speed is vital for applications like decentralized exchanges, gaming, and micropayments, where real-time interactions are crucial.
Enhanced Privacy
Certain Layer 2 solutions, like state channels and zero-knowledge rollups, provide enhanced privacy features. Participants can transact privately off-chain, reducing the exposure of sensitive data on the Layer 1 blockchain. This is particularly beneficial for use cases that require confidentiality.
Energy Efficiency
With their reduced reliance on energy-intensive consensus mechanisms like Proof of Work (PoW), Layer 2 Blockchains contribute to a more sustainable blockchain ecosystem. This aligns with the growing emphasis on environmental concerns within the crypto community.
These advantages make Layer 2 solutions a game-changer for blockchain technology. They not only alleviate the pain points associated with Layer 1 Blockchains but also enable entirely new use cases and experiences within the crypto space.
Challenges and Concerns
While Layer 2 Blockchains hold immense promise, they are not without their share of challenges and concerns. It's essential to address these issues to ensure the continued growth and adoption of Layer 2 solutions.
Security Risks
One of the primary concerns surrounding Layer 2 solutions is security. Since many transactions occur off-chain and only final results are settled on the Layer 1 blockchain, there is a risk of fraud or disputes. However, most Layer 2 solutions implement various security measures, such as smart contract-based dispute resolution or cryptographic proofs, to mitigate these risks.
Interoperability
Achieving seamless interoperability between different Layer 2 solutions and Layer 1 blockchains is an ongoing challenge. The crypto community is actively working on standards and protocols to ensure that assets and data can move freely between various layers.
Adoption Hurdles
Widespread adoption of Layer 2 Blockchains requires educating developers and users about these solutions. Some users may be hesitant to adopt new technologies, and developers may face a learning curve when implementing Layer 2 features into their applications.
Centralization Concerns
Certain Layer 2 solutions might inadvertently introduce centralization, especially if they rely heavily on a limited number of validators or operators. Ensuring a healthy degree of decentralization is crucial to maintaining the integrity and trustworthiness of Layer 2 networks.
Regulatory Scrutiny
As Layer 2 solutions gain popularity, they may attract the attention of regulators. The crypto community needs to engage in constructive dialogues with regulatory bodies to ensure that Layer 2 technology can continue to thrive within a compliant framework.
Despite these challenges, the crypto community remains committed to addressing these concerns and advancing the development of Layer 2 solutions. Security audits, decentralized governance models, and collaborative efforts are just some of how these issues are being tackled.
Popular Layer 2 Projects
The success of Layer 2 Blockchains is attributed to the innovative projects that have been at the forefront of their development. Here are some prominent Layer 2 projects and their contributions to the blockchain space.
Optimistic Ethereum
Optimistic Ethereum is a Layer 2 scaling solution for the Ethereum network. It employs an optimistic roll-up design, allowing for faster and cheaper transactions while maintaining compatibility with Ethereum's existing smart contracts. This project has the potential to alleviate many of the congestion and fee issues experienced by Ethereum users.
Polygon (formerly Matic)
Polygon is a Layer 2 scaling solution and framework for building Ethereum-compatible blockchains. It offers a range of tools and infrastructure to simplify the development of decentralized applications (dApps) and facilitates interoperability between various Layer 2 solutions. Polygon has gained widespread adoption and is a key player in Ethereum's scalability efforts.
Lightning Network
The Lightning Network is a Layer 2 solution for Bitcoin that enables fast and low-cost microtransactions. It functions as a network of payment channels that allow users to transact off-chain. Lightning has the potential to revolutionize Bitcoin's use cases, making it suitable for everyday transactions.
Arbitrum
Arbitrum is another Layer 2 solution for Ethereum, known for its compatibility with existing Ethereum smart contracts. It uses an optimistic roll-up approach to enhance scalability and reduce transaction costs, making it an attractive choice for developers and users looking to mitigate Ethereum's limitations.
These projects are just a glimpse of the vibrant ecosystem of Layer 2 solutions. Each project contributes its unique strengths and innovations, furthering the development and adoption of Layer 2 technology.
Use Cases and Applications
Layer 2 Blockchains have the potential to transform a wide range of industries and applications within the blockchain ecosystem. Here are some notable use cases where Layer 2 technology is making a significant impact.
Decentralized Finance (DeFi)
Layer 2 solutions play a crucial role in the DeFi space, where high transaction fees and slow confirmation times have been major challenges. Layer 2 networks like Optimistic Ethereum and Polygon enable DeFi platforms to offer faster, more cost-effective trading, lending, and yield farming services.
Non-Fungible Tokens (NFTs)
The explosion of interest in NFTs, which are unique digital assets, has put significant strain on blockchain networks. Layer 2 solutions provide a more efficient and cost-effective environment for trading and interacting with NFTs, making them more accessible to artists, collectors, and creators.
Gaming
Gaming is another sector benefiting from Layer 2 Blockchains. Scalable Layer 2 networks facilitate real-time in-game transactions, asset ownership, and digital item trading. This enhances the gaming experience and opens up new revenue streams for game developers.
Micropayments and Content Streaming
Content creators, including musicians, artists, and writers, can leverage Layer 2 technology for microtransactions. This enables consumers to make small, frequent payments for access to content without incurring high transaction fees.
Supply Chain and Logistics
Layer 2 solutions enhance the transparency and efficiency of supply chain management. They enable real-time tracking and verification of goods and transactions, reducing fraud and errors in supply chain operations.
Social Media and Communities
Layer 2 Blockchains can power decentralized social media platforms and online communities. These platforms offer users more control over their data and content while reducing the reliance on centralized intermediaries.
Cross-Border Payments
Efficient and low-cost Layer 2 solutions are well-suited for cross-border payments and remittances. They offer a faster and more affordable alternative to traditional banking systems, especially in regions with limited access to financial services.
These use cases highlight the versatility and potential of Layer 2 Blockchains. By addressing scalability and cost issues, they enable a wide array of blockchain applications to flourish, ultimately contributing to the broader adoption of decentralized technologies.
Adoption and Future Outlook
The adoption of Layer 2 Blockchains is gaining momentum within the blockchain ecosystem. As the advantages of Layer 2 solutions become increasingly apparent, more projects, developers, and users are embracing these technologies.
Current Adoption
Several prominent Layer 2 projects, such as Polygon, Arbitrum, and Optimistic Ethereum, have garnered substantial attention and user adoption. DeFi platforms, NFT marketplaces, and gaming dApps are among the early adopters benefiting from the enhanced scalability and cost-efficiency offered by Layer 2 solutions.
Mainstream Potential
The potential for Layer 2 Blockchains to bring blockchain technology closer to mainstream adoption is undeniable. Faster and cheaper transactions make blockchain more appealing for everyday use cases, such as online purchases and microtransactions and reduce the environmental impact associated with energy-intensive blockchains.
Future Developments
The future of Layer 2 Blockchains looks promising. As the crypto community continues to address challenges related to security, interoperability, and education, we can expect further innovation in Layer 2 technologies. New projects and solutions are likely to emerge, catering to specific industries and use cases.
Interconnected Ecosystem
Layer 2 Blockchains are not isolated systems; they exist within an interconnected blockchain ecosystem. As Layer 2 networks continue to evolve, they will create bridges and interoperability solutions that seamlessly connect different blockchains, enabling assets and data to move fluidly between layers.
Regulatory Considerations
As adoption grows, regulatory scrutiny is also expected to increase. Regulatory bodies worldwide are developing guidelines for blockchain technology, which will impact the development and deployment of Layer 2 solutions. Engaging with regulators and adhering to compliance standards will be crucial for the continued success of Layer 2 projects.
In conclusion, Layer 2 Blockchains represent a pivotal advancement in blockchain technology. Their ability to address scalability challenges, reduce transaction costs, and enhance speed makes them a vital component of the blockchain ecosystem. As these solutions continue to mature and gain widespread adoption, they hold the potential to transform industries, enable new use cases, and bring blockchain closer to the masses.